In today’s fast-paced business environment, managing data efficiently is more critical than ever. Enter SSIS-950, Microsoft’s advanced data integration tool designed to streamline data processes and provide actionable insights.
What is SSIS-950?
SSIS-950 stands for SQL Server Integration Services version 950. It’s an evolution of Microsoft’s ETL (Extract, Transform, Load) platform, introduced with SQL Server 2017. This tool enables businesses to extract data from various sources, transform it into usable formats, and load it into destinations like data warehouses or analytics platforms. With SSIS-950, companies can handle complex data integration tasks more efficiently, ensuring that data flows seamlessly across systems.
Key Features of SSIS-950
- Comprehensive ETL Capabilities
- Extraction: SSIS-950 can pull data from diverse sources, including SQL Server, Oracle, MySQL, flat files, XML, and cloud platforms like Azure and AWS.
- Transformation: It offers advanced tools for data cleansing, fuzzy lookups, and conditional splits, ensuring that data is accurate and consistent.
- Loading: Processed data is efficiently loaded into destinations, minimizing downtime and ensuring high availability.
- Performance Optimization
- Parallel Processing: SSIS-950 executes multiple ETL tasks simultaneously, reducing processing time for large datasets.
- Optimized Memory Management: It ensures efficient use of system resources, even when handling high-volume data loads.
- Cloud and Hybrid Integration
- Deep integration with Azure allows seamless data flow between on-premises and cloud environments.
- Supports hybrid setups, making it ideal for businesses transitioning to the cloud.
- User-Friendly Interface
- An intuitive drag-and-drop interface makes complex ETL workflows accessible to both technical and non-technical users.
- Pre-built components reduce development time and effort.
- Advanced Data Transformation Tools
- Includes powerful tools for data conversion, aggregation, pivoting, and error handling, ensuring flexible and reliable data transformation processes.
Why Choose SSIS-950 Over Previous Versions?
Feature | SSIS-950 | Previous Versions |
---|---|---|
Performance | Parallel processing, optimized memory | Sequential processing, higher latency |
Cloud Integration | Seamless Azure and hybrid integration | Limited cloud support |
Error Handling | Enhanced logging and error redirection | Basic mechanisms |
Transformation Tools | Comprehensive, supports complex tasks | Limited transformation capabilities |
Scalability | High scalability for large datasets | Moderate scalability |
Practical Applications of SSIS-950
- Data Warehousing
- Consolidates data from various sources into centralized repositories, enabling efficient analysis of large datasets.
- Data Migration
- Ensures data integrity during system upgrades or platform transitions by securely transferring information across systems.
- Business Intelligence
- Integrates data for platforms like Power BI, allowing organizations to derive actionable insights and make informed decisions.
- Cloud Data Integration
- Robust Azure integration helps businesses adopt cloud technologies while maintaining data continuity.
Benefits of Using SSIS-950
- Enhanced Data Quality: Advanced cleansing tools improve data accuracy and consistency.
- Improved Efficiency: Streamlined ETL workflows reduce time and effort spent on manual processes.
- Cost Savings: Seamless integration with Microsoft products minimizes the need for additional software investments.
- Scalability: Adapts to growing data volumes, ensuring reliable performance.
Implementing SSIS-950
- Installation and Setup
- Install SQL Server Data Tools (SSDT) and configure SSIS on your SQL Server.
- Designing ETL Processes
- Utilize the drag-and-drop interface to design workflows, leveraging pre-built components for efficiency.
- Testing and Deployment
- Validate workflows using built-in testing tools. Deploy only after ensuring seamless functionality.
- Monitoring and Maintenance
- Regularly monitor ETL processes and address anomalies proactively. Keep the system updated for optimal performance.
Best Practices for Using SSIS-950
- Optimize Data Flows: Reduce unnecessary transformations to improve processing times.
- Leverage Parallel Processing: Distribute workloads effectively for faster ETL processes.
- Implement Error Handling: Use robust error-logging and redirection tools to maintain data integrity.
Future of Data Integration with SSIS-950
- AI Integration: Future versions may incorporate AI-driven data analytics and automation.
- Enhanced Cloud Support: Expanded capabilities for hybrid and multi-cloud environments.
- Real-Time Processing: Improved real-time analytics for faster decision-making.
Conclusion
SSIS-950 is a comprehensive solution for modern data integration needs. Its robust ETL capabilities, performance optimizations, and seamless integration with the Microsoft ecosystem make it indispensable for businesses. Whether consolidating data for analytics or migrating systems, SSIS-950 empowers organizations to manage data efficiently and drive growth.
FAQs
- What is SSIS-950 used for?
- SSIS-950 is used for advanced ETL processes and data integration, helping businesses consolidate and manage data from multiple sources.
- How does SSIS-950 differ from previous versions?
- It features improved performance, cloud integration, and enhanced error-handling, making it more efficient than previous versions.
- Can SSIS-950 integrate with cloud platforms like Azure?
- Yes, SSIS